Impact Mode
<Nutrunner mode> In this Nutrunner mode the tool tightens by continuously increasing torque until target torque is achieved. <Impact mode> Fastening in "Impact" mode controls motor speeds and impact frequency. The tool motor starts and stops to create an impact effect which reduces torque reaction. It also helps reduce operator strain and repetitive motion injuries. (Patented in Japan.) Use Impact mode fastening for all types of joint conditions simply by adjusting speeds and impact frequency. (*For use with models with Impact mode only.)

Auto Adjusted Impact Mode Fastening
The SHDN series tool offers an Impact mode setting that automatically adjusts pulse speed and frequency to create repeatable torque accuracy with minimum reaction. This Auto Impact mode is perfect for changing joint conditions on the same work piece (ex.soft joint / hard joint).
Batch Count Function
Batch count function is available for tracking multiple fastening cycles in a single workpiece. Once the set number of cycles in the batch are completed satisfactorily an OK signal is sent. Each cycle in the batch can run the same program and parameters or unique program and parameters. This is useful when tightening to different torques or using different fastening methods within a single workpiece. Additional settings are available to increase the tools production process flexibility. Optional settings such as Count UP/DOWN indication, fastening OK count/OK+NG count, count backward/forward are available to meet your various tightening processes.
Cross Thread Prevention Function
Option
The nutrunner recognizes whether the bolt is oriented straight during the counterclockwise running, and after checking the posture of the bolt and the edge of first pitch, it immediately rotates forward to prevent the cross thread.
Operator Influence Angle Auto Correction Function
Option
By equipping an optional tool Gyro sensor, loss angle by hand shake can be corrected to accurate angle. This function observes and calculates the angle of the tool while fastening in real time.

User Interface Terminal Software (UIT)
NUTRUNNER SUPPORT SOFTWARE
By using the User Interface Terminal Software, fastening parameters & programs can be set up and storage fastening data and torque curve data can be collected. Recorded data can be saved as a file, and can be outputted to the file such as CSV. User Interface Terminal has two versions Basic and Full. Basic version allows for fastening setting and storage fastening data display. The Full version supports all UIT functions such as data acquisition, torque curve monitoring, maintenance etc.
